文字ホスト変数

文字ホスト変数の宣言の構文は、次のとおりです。

DECLARE var-name-spec CHARACTER [(length)] [VARYING] align-scope-storage ;

詳細は次のとおりです。

var-name-spec {variable-name | (variable-name, ...)}
align-scope-storage PL/I 整列、範囲、または記憶域のクラス属性の任意のセット

注:
  • 可変でない文字ホスト変数の場合、長さは SQL CHAR データの最大長を超えない定数にする必要があります。
  • 可変長の文字ホスト変数の場合、長さは SQL LONG VARCHAR データの最大長を超える定数にする必要があります。
  • DCL、CHAR、VAR は、それぞれ DECLARE、CHARACTER、VARYING の省略形として使用できます。